#pragma once
#include <AzCore/Component/Component.h>
#include <AzCore/Component/ComponentBus.h>
#include <GradientSignal/GradientSampler.h>
#include <GradientSignal/Ebuses/DitherGradientRequestBus.h>
#include <GradientSignal/Ebuses/GradientRequestBus.h>
#include <LmbrCentral/Dependency/DependencyMonitor.h>
#include <GradientSignal/Ebuses/SectorDataRequestBus.h>
namespace LmbrCentral
{
template<typename, typename>
class EditorWrappedComponentBase;
}
namespace GradientSignal
{
class DitherGradientConfig
: public AZ::ComponentConfig
{
public:
AZ_CLASS_ALLOCATOR(DitherGradientConfig, AZ::SystemAllocator, 0);
AZ_RTTI(DitherGradientConfig, "{8F519317-4E83-4CF0-BEC9-C5F3F3198F20}", AZ::ComponentConfig);
static void Reflect(AZ::ReflectContext* context);
bool m_useSystemPointsPerUnit = true;
float m_pointsPerUnit = 1.0f;
AZ::Vector3 m_patternOffset = AZ::Vector3::CreateZero();
enum class BayerPatternType : AZ::u8
{
PATTERN_SIZE_4x4 = 4,
PATTERN_SIZE_8x8 = 8,
};
BayerPatternType m_patternType = BayerPatternType::PATTERN_SIZE_4x4;
GradientSampler m_gradientSampler;
bool IsPointsPerUnitResdOnly() const;
};
static const AZ::Uuid DitherGradientComponentTypeId = "{F69E885E-9D43-480D-A549-E5EE503A8F29}";
/**
* calculates a gradient output value by applying ordered dithering to the input gradient value
*/
class DitherGradientComponent
: public AZ::Component
, private GradientRequestBus::Handler
, private DitherGradientRequestBus::Handler
, private SectorDataNotificationBus::Handler
{
public:
template<typename, typename> friend class LmbrCentral::EditorWrappedComponentBase;
AZ_COMPONENT(DitherGradientComponent, DitherGradientComponentTypeId);
static void GetProvidedServices(AZ::ComponentDescriptor::DependencyArrayType& services);
static void GetIncompatibleServices(AZ::ComponentDescriptor::DependencyArrayType& services);
static void GetRequiredServices(AZ::ComponentDescriptor::DependencyArrayType& services);
static void Reflect(AZ::ReflectContext* context);
DitherGradientComponent(const DitherGradientConfig& configuration);
DitherGradientComponent() = default;
~DitherGradientComponent() = default;
//////////////////////////////////////////////////////////////////////////
// AZ::Component interface implementation
void Activate() override;
void Deactivate() override;
bool ReadInConfig(const AZ::ComponentConfig* baseConfig) override;
bool WriteOutConfig(AZ::ComponentConfig* outBaseConfig) const override;
//////////////////////////////////////////////////////////////////////////
// GradientRequestBus
float GetValue(const GradientSampleParams& sampleParams) const override;
bool IsEntityInHierarchy(const AZ::EntityId& entityId) const override;
//////////////////////////////////////////////////////////////////////////
// SectorDataNotificationBus
void OnSectorDataConfigurationUpdated() const override;
protected:
//////////////////////////////////////////////////////////////////////////
// DitheredGradientRequestBus
bool GetUseSystemPointsPerUnit() const override;
void SetUseSystemPointsPerUnit(bool value) override;
float GetPointsPerUnit() const override;
void SetPointsPerUnit(float points) override;
AZ::Vector3 GetPatternOffset() const override;
void SetPatternOffset(AZ::Vector3 offset) override;
AZ::u8 GetPatternType() const override;
void SetPatternType(AZ::u8 type) override;
GradientSampler& GetGradientSampler() override;
private:
DitherGradientConfig m_configuration;
LmbrCentral::DependencyMonitor m_dependencyMonitor;
};
}
